Conditions / Refusal Reasons
That the works hereby permitted shall be begun before the expiration of three years from the date of this consent.
Reason: By virtue of Section 18 of the Planning (Listed Buildings and Conservation Areas) Act 1990 as amended by section 51 of the Planning and Compulsory Purchase Act 2004.
That all new works and works of making good the retained fabric, both internal and external, shall be finished to match the adjacent work with regard to the methods used and to material, colour, texture and profile.
Reason: To ensure the details of the proposal are satisfactory in accordance with Policies CON2 and CON3 of the South Oxfordshire Local Plan.
Detailed drawings at a scale of 1:1 and 1:10 for the proposed new door to the front elevation of the extension, the new kitchen window to the rear elevation of the extension, and new widened door to existing kitchen shall be submitted to and approved in writing by the Local Planning Authority, prior to works commencing on site.
Reason: To ensure the details of the proposal are satisfactory in accordance with Policies CON2 and CON3 of the South Oxfordshire Local Plan.
Samples of materials and sample panels for the hand made clay roofing tiles and external lime render finish for the extension shall be submitted to and approved in writing by the Local Planning Authority, prior to works commencing on site.
Reason: To ensure the details of the proposal are satisfactory in accordance with Policies CON2 and CON3 of the South Oxfordshire Local Plan.
